Введение в Storage vMotion и его управление в VMware


Storage vMotion – это функция виртуализации хранилища, которая доступна в VMware vSphere. Она позволяет перемещать виртуальные машины между хранилищами данных без прерывания их работы. Storage vMotion обеспечивает гибкость и масштабируемость виртуальных сред, позволяя эффективно управлять ресурсами хранилища.

С помощью Storage vMotion администраторы могут производить перенос виртуальных машин на другие хранилища для балансировки загрузки, резервного копирования, обновления оборудования или миграции между системами хранения данных. Эта функция позволяет снизить деградацию производительности и минимизировать простои виртуальных машин во время переноса.

Управление Storage vMotion осуществляется через VMware vCenter Server, который предоставляет графический интерфейс для процесса перемещения виртуальных машин. Администраторы могут выбрать виртуальную машину, указать новое хранилище и запустить процесс перемещения. VMware vCenter Server автоматически и безопасно перемещает виртуальную машину и ее хранилище, обеспечивая непрерывную работу и сохранение целостности данных.

Storage vMotion также предоставляет возможность выполнять перемещение виртуальных машин между несколькими хранилищами одновременно, что упрощает процесс балансировки нагрузки и улучшает производительность системы хранения данных. Благодаря возможности перемещать виртуальные машины без остановки работы, администраторы могут производить обслуживание и обновление хранилищ без воздействия на работу бизнес-приложений.

Storage vMotion: основные понятия

Основные понятия, связанные с Storage vMotion:

Хранилище данных (Datastore) – это место, где хранятся файлы виртуальных машин, такие как конфигурационные файлы, дисковые образы и т. д. В платформе VMware vSphere хранилища данных могут быть реализованы на различных типах хранилищ, таких как локальные диски серверов, сетевые хранилища (NAS) или блочные устройства (SAN).

Хост (Host) – это физический сервер, на котором располагается платформа VMware vSphere и выполняются виртуальные машины.

Виртуальная машина (Virtual Machine) – это независимая от аппаратных ресурсов программная среда, которая эмулирует аппаратную платформу. Она включает в себя виртуальные процессоры, память, диски и другие устройства.

Storage vMotion (SvMotion) – это процесс перемещения виртуальной машины с одного хранилища данных на другое без прерывания ее работы. В ходе перемещения происходит копирование данных в фоновом режиме с одного хранилища на другое, а затем обновление конфигурации виртуальной машины так, чтобы она начала использовать новое хранилище.

Хранилище источника (Source Datastore) – это хранилище данных, с которого перемещается виртуальная машина.

Хранилище назначения (Destination Datastore) – это хранилище данных, на которое перемещается виртуальная машина.

Временное хранилище (Transient Storage) – это временное хранилище, используемое при перемещении виртуальной машины, когда ее дисковые файлы еще не были полностью скопированы на хранилище назначения. Временное хранилище помогает обеспечить непрерывность работы виртуальной машины во время перемещения.

Storage vMotion позволяет администраторам гибко управлять ресурсами хранилища данных, распределять нагрузку и обеспечивать непрерывность работы виртуальных машин. Эта технология значительно упрощает задачи администрирования и повышает гибкость и эффективность виртуализованной инфраструктуры.

Что такое Storage vMotion

Storage vMotion отвечает на растущую потребность в миграции данных виртуальных машин без остановки их работы. Позволяет переносить виртуальные машины на другие хранилища данных для балансировки нагрузки или обновления хранилищ без простоя сервисов. Эта технология также позволяет выполнять миграцию виртуальных машин с устаревшего или проблемного хранилища на новое, более производительное или надежное хранилище без влияния на работу пользователей.

Чтобы использовать Storage vMotion, необходимо иметь доступ к инфраструктуре VMware vSphere и настроить соответствующие хранилища данных. Начиная с vSphere 6.0, Storage vMotion также позволяет перемещать виртуальные машины между различными хостами. Контрольная панель VMware vSphere Client предоставляет интуитивно понятный интерфейс для управления Storage vMotion и выполнения миграций виртуальных машин.

Как работает Storage vMotion в VMware

Для выполнения операции Storage vMotion в VMware необходимо выполнить следующие шаги:

  1. Выберите виртуальную машину, которую вы хотите переместить, и перейдите во вкладку «Настройки».
  2. Выберите раздел «Управление» и перейдите в раздел «Перемещение хранилища данных».
  3. Выберите новое хранилище данных, куда вы хотите переместить виртуальные диски и файлы.
  4. Нажмите кнопку «Переместить», чтобы запустить процесс Storage vMotion.

В ходе выполнения Storage vMotion все активные операции чтения и записи будут перенаправлены на новое хранилище данных, чтобы минимизировать простой работы виртуальных машин. После успешного завершения операции Storage vMotion виртуальные диски и файлы будут находиться на новом хранилище данных, а работа виртуальных машин будет продолжена без прерывания.

Storage vMotion позволяет оптимизировать использование хранилища данных виртуализованной инфраструктуры, позволяя перемещать виртуальные диски и файлы в более удобные и безопасные места. Это особенно полезно при обслуживании оборудования, масштабировании или смене поставщика хранилища данных.

Управление Storage vMotion

Чтобы использовать Storage vMotion, необходимо выполнить следующие шаги:

  1. Перейти в клиент vSphere и выбрать виртуальную машину, которую необходимо переместить.
  2. Нажмите правой кнопкой мыши на выбранной виртуальной машине и выберите пункт меню «Миграция».
  3. В раскрывшемся меню выберите опцию «Storage vMotion».
  4. Выберите хранилище назначения, куда вы хотите переместить виртуальную машину и ее диски.
  5. Нажмите кнопку «Далее» и просмотрите все параметры миграции.
  6. Подтвердите настройки и начните операцию миграции Storage vMotion.

Во время процесса миграции, VMware vSphere будет автоматически копировать виртуальные диски на новое хранилище и обновлять информацию о месте их хранения. Виртуальная машина будет недоступная на короткий промежуток времени, но пользователи не заметят этого простоя, так как работа будет продолжаться на виртуальной машине, пока она не будет полностью перемещена на новое хранилище.

Управление Storage vMotion позволяет эффективно использовать ресурсы хранилищ VMware и обеспечивает гибкость в управлении виртуальными машинами и их дисками. Он помогает минимизировать простои в работе виртуальных машин и повышает отказоустойчивость инфраструктуры.

Настройка и конфигурация Storage vMotion

Для использования Storage vMotion в VMware необходимо выполнить несколько шагов.

1. Проверьте совместимость: Убедитесь, что ваша версия VMware поддерживает Storage vMotion. Проверьте документацию и совместимость с вашими хранилищами данных.

2. Подготовка хранилища данных: Убедитесь, что хранилище данных, на которое вы планируете перемещать виртуальные машины, поддерживает Storage vMotion. Убедитесь, что оно подключено к кластеру VMware и правильно настроено.

3. Создание дополнительного VMkernel-адаптера: Сначала вам потребуется создать дополнительный VMkernel-адаптер на хосте, чтобы разделить трафик Storage vMotion от обычного сетевого трафика. Настройте IP-адрес, маску подсети и другие необходимые параметры.

4. Включение Storage vMotion: В веб-интерфейсе vSphere Client войдите в свое виртуальное окружение vSphere и выберите хост или кластер, на котором вы хотите включить Storage vMotion. Выберите вкладку «Настройки» и перейдите в «Конфигурация». Включите опцию Storage vMotion.

5. Настройка сети: В меню «Настройки» выберите «Сеть» и затем «Конфигурация TCP/IP». Настройте VMkernel-адаптер для Storage vMotion, задайте IP-адрес и другие требуемые параметры сети.

6. Перемещение виртуальных машин: Теперь вы можете перемещать виртуальные машины между хранилищами данных с помощью функции Storage vMotion. Выберите виртуальную машину, щелкните правой кнопкой мыши и выберите «Migrate». В диалоговом окне выберите «Change datastore» и следуйте инструкциям мастера для выполнения перемещения.

Примечание: Перемещение виртуальных машин может занимать некоторое время, особенно при больших размерах файлов. Учитывайте этот фактор при планировании перемещений.

Управление процессом перемещения данных

Для того чтобы переместить данные с помощью VMware vSphere Client, необходимо выбрать виртуальную машину, для которой требуется перемещение, затем кликнуть правой кнопкой мыши и выбрать в меню пункт «Миграция» (Migrate). В открывшемся окне выбирается тип миграции «Storage vMotion». Затем необходимо выбрать хранилище данных назначения и настройки миграции, такие как пропуск возможных ошибок и настройки сети. После подтверждения, процесс перемещения данных будет запущен и можно будет отслеживать его прогресс.

Для управления процессом перемещения данных с помощью командной строки, необходимо использовать инструмент vmotion.pl. Синтаксис команды выглядит следующим образом:

vmotion.pl -r vm_name -s «source_datastore» -d «destination_datastore»

Где vm_name — имя виртуальной машины, source_datastore — исходное хранилище данных, destination_datastore — хранилище данных назначения. Запустив данную команду, процесс перемещения данных будет инициирован и можно будет отслеживать его выполнение.

Управление процессом перемещения данных в VMware позволяет эффективно управлять распределением нагрузки на хранилища данных и обеспечивает гибкость в планировании обслуживания и обновления физического оборудования.

Преимущества Storage vMotion

Технология Storage vMotion в VMware предлагает ряд значительных преимуществ для эффективного управления хранилищами данных:

1.

Безостановочная миграция: Storage vMotion позволяет перемещать виртуальные машины между хранилищами данных без прерывания их работы. Это означает, что пользователи и приложения могут продолжать работу без прерывания доступа к данным, что особенно важно для бизнес-процессов, требующих непрерывной работы.

2.

Улучшение операционной эффективности: Storage vMotion позволяет равномерно распределять загрузку между различными хранилищами данных, освобождая ресурсы и позволяя использовать их более эффективно. Это может быть особенно полезно при работе с физическими устройствами, на которых возникают узкие места или проблемы с производительностью.

3.

Улучшение отказоустойчивости: Storage vMotion позволяет перемещать виртуальные машины с одного хранилища данных на другое, что повышает отказоустойчивость системы. Если одно из хранилищ данных не доступно по каким-либо причинам, виртуальные машины можно быстро перенести на другое хранилище без потери доступа к данным и непрерывности работы.

4.

Удобное масштабирование хранилищ: Storage vMotion позволяет легко расширять емкость хранилищ данных путем добавления новых устройств хранения или перемещения данных на существующие устройства с меньшей загрузкой. Это позволяет гибко управлять ресурсами хранилища в зависимости от текущих требований и обеспечивать достаточное пространство для данных виртуальных машин.

Storage vMotion — мощный инструмент для управления хранилищами данных в виртуальной среде VMware, который позволяет повысить эффективность и гибкость работы системы.

Гибкость и удобство

Storage vMotion в VMware обеспечивает гибкость и удобство при перемещении хранилища виртуальных машин между физическими хранилищами без остановки их работы. Это позволяет администраторам эффективно управлять ресурсами, улучшать производительность и обеспечивать непрерывность работы системы.

С помощью Storage vMotion администраторы могут перемещать виртуальные машины на другие дисковые массивы или хранилища без прерывания работы приложений, что обеспечивает минимальное время простоя и повышает доступность сервисов. Кроме того, этот инструмент позволяет управлять нагрузкой на физические хранилища, балансировать нагрузку и распределять ресурсы между серверами.

Еще одним преимуществом Storage vMotion является возможность проведения работ по обновлению и обслуживанию оборудования без остановки работы виртуальных машин. Администраторы могут перемещать виртуальные машины на другое хранилище, освобождать место для замены дисков или обновления программного обеспечения, не нарушая работу пользователей.

Благодаря гибкости и удобству Storage vMotion, администраторы могут быть уверены в непрерывной работе виртуальных машин и эффективном использовании ресурсов хранилища. Этот инструмент является важным компонентом виртуализации и позволяет оптимизировать производительность и доступность системы.

Добавить комментарий

Вам также может понравиться